Apply the stain using the sprayer to one side of the railing, lifting one end of the canvas tarp. The opposite side of the canvas tarp will catch the overspray. Walk around to the opposite side and repeat this process, applying the stain on both sides. Make sure to get the outside edge of deck floor as well.Start by dipping the paint brush into the stain. Apply the stain onto two to three boards at a time, using long even strokes, going from one end to the other. Try to avoid making ‘lap marks’ on stain deck wood. …Semi-Transparent Stain. These will impart some color to the deck but will also keep the wood grain pattern visible. They’re most used for external deck staining as it’ll soak into the wood and last longer than clear stains. It’s also less likely to peel off the surface, but you will need to reapply when it loses color.Provides durable, opaque protection for many exterior horizontal wood surfaces. This is the stain to choose for a regal finish on hardwood decks.Sanding a deck before staining provides a clean, smooth, and absorbent surface for stain and paint to adhere to. It is a key part of cleaning and preparing a deck for finishing. Most decks take two passes with a power sander; the first with 20 to 50 grit and the second with 60 to 80. Expect to take 5-hours for the two passes on 100sqft of decking.Follow these steps to clean a wooden deck to have a pristine surface ready for staining (or painting). 1. Sweep. Sweep away leaf litter and other dirt before you bring out the cleaning agent. If you see pieces of debris wedged between the boards, use a putty knife to tease them out. 2.Stain is absorbed into the wood, while paint creates a barrier on top of the wood. This means that stain will highlight the grain of the wood, while paint will cover it up. Stain is also easier to touch up than paint. If you have a small section of your deck that starts to fade, you can simply stain that area without having to repaint the ...

Start at the top step and work your way down, ensuring you cover every crevice. To remove old deck stain from the wood you have to use a deck stripper. A quality deck stripper will break up and soften any old stain allowing it to be washed away. Most deck strippers will not remove solid stain or paints if this is the case you may have to sand the old stain to get back down to bare wood again.

Deck stains fall into three categories: transparent, semi-transparent, and solid. The amount of pigment and oils in the stain determines its type. More pigment generally means more protection for the wood deck.
